Born on May 14, 2002, this Canadian prodigy has quickly become a name synonymous with dominance in the paint. Drafted in the first round (9th pick, 9th overall) of the 2024 NBA draft by the Memphis Grizzlies, Edey's arrival in the league has been met with both excitement and anticipation. Standing at an imposing 7'4" and weighing in at 305 lbs, Edey presents a physical presence that immediately commands attention. His journey to the NBA is a testament to years of dedication and a clear understanding of the game, honed during his collegiate career with the Purdue Boilermakers. He led his team to the NCAA Division I Men's Basketball Championship game in his final year, further solidifying his reputation as a force to be reckoned with.

Category | Details |
---|---|
Full Name | Zachary Edey |
Date of Birth | May 14, 2002 |
Place of Birth | Canada |
Height | 7'4" |
Weight | 305 lbs (138 kg) |
Position | Center |
NBA Draft | 2024, 1st round (9th pick, 9th overall), Memphis Grizzlies |
College | Purdue University |
Current Team | Memphis Grizzlies |
Notable Achievements | NCAA Division I Men's Basketball Championship Game appearance |
